DC Universe architect, James Gunn, explained how his real-life dog inspired him to include a super canine in his upcoming SUPERMAN movie.

“Krypto arrives on screens in SUPERMAN this summer,” Gunn wrote on Instagram. “Krypto was inspired by our dog Ozu, who we adopted shortly after I started writing Superman. Ozu, who came from a hoarding situation in a backyard with 60 other dogs & never knew human beings, was problematic to say the least. He immediately came in & destroyed our home, our shoes, our furniture – he even ate my laptop. It took a long time before he would even let us touch him.”

“I remember thinking, ‘Gosh, how difficult would life be if Ozu had superpowers?’ – and thus Krypto came into the script & changed the shape of the story as Ozu was changing my life, Gunn continued. “What better time to debut the not-so-good-good-boy Krypto than #AdoptAShelterDog month. Btw, Ozu today, is, fairly often, a very good boy.”

While Krypto, a super powered dog from Superman’s home planet has been a part of the DC comic universe since 1955, he has never appeared in a live-action movie. The dog has traditionally sported super strength, intelligence, and senses, per Variety.

Krypto adds onto SUPERMAN’s extensive character list, all of who play important roles according to Gunn. The director has previously shared how he disapproves of including recognizable characters for no reason. The current character list includes Superman, Lois Lane, Lex Luther, Jimmy Olson, and Eve Teschmacher.

“The whole point was it’s NOT a large film – I mean, not in terms of cast,” Gunn said last December. “It’s normal for single protagonist films to have other characters – much more unusual for them not to.”

“I don’t mind actual cameos – if it’s a glimpse or a moment, an Easter egg,” Gunn continued. “What bothers me is when they mangle an elegant story by shoehorning characters in – they aren’t there because the story calls for it, but for some other reason.”

SUPERMAN wrapped filming earlier this year and is set to release in July of 2025, kicking off the new DC Universe.

James Gunn thanked Cleveland for being such a great host while filming took place in the city and revealed that the shoot for the movie has almost been completed.

“Today we are leaving you (Cleveland) after six amazing weeks of shooting,” Gunn wrote on social media. “From the moment we first came here on a scout a tad less than a year ago and Terminal Tower was lit up with the colors of Superman, I knew you were a special place. I would walk down your streets and someone would stop me and tell me how grateful they were we were shooting in their city – not once, not twice, but dozens of times.

“The wonderful background actors on the film were always so fun and funny and they clapped after takes, something that reminded us Hollywood cynics why we make movies in the first place,” Gunn continued. “The pride you feel in being the city where Jerry and Joe first created Superman was invigorating. You exemplify his spirit. But just as much it’s the pride you have in your community, your hometown, your radio stations and restaurants and gathering places that touched me.”

“Every city would be so lucky to have people that loved their city as much as you do,” Gunn concluded his post. “You simply can’t have been more wonderful, kind or accommodating to me and our performers and crew. Thank you a thousand times over for being our friends and partners on this film. Much love to you all. ?‍♂️❤️”
